Bhardhari Population - Kishanganj, Bihar

Bhardhari is a medium size village located in Terhagachh Block of Kishanganj district, Bihar with total 88 families residing. The Bhardhari village has population of 317 of which 182 are males while 135 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Bhardhari village population of children with age 0-6 is 45 which makes up 14.20 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Bhardhari village is 742 which is lower than Bihar state average of 918. Child Sex Ratio for the Bhardhari as per census is 452, lower than Bihar average of 935.

Bhardhari village has higher literacy rate compared to Bihar. In 2011, literacy rate of Bhardhari village was 81.62 % compared to 61.80 % of Bihar. In Bhardhari Male literacy stands at 92.05 % while female literacy rate was 68.60 %.

Bhardhari Data

Particulars Total Male Female
Total No. of Houses 88 - -
Population 317 182 135
Child (0-6) 45 31 14
Schedule Caste 46 25 21
Schedule Tribe 0 0 0
Literacy 81.62 % 92.05 % 68.60 %
Total Workers 99 87 12
Main Worker 46 - -
Marginal Worker 53 45 8

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 14.51 % of total population in Bhardhari village. The village Bhardhari curr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Bhardhari village out of total population, 99 were engaged in work activities. 46.46 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 53.54 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 99 workers engaged in Main Work, 36 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
